From mboxrd@z Thu Jan 1 00:00:00 1970 From: Daniel Vetter Subject: Re: [PATCH 01/15] drm/i915: Allocate min dbuf blocks per bspec Date: Wed, 30 Sep 2015 14:20:20 +0200 Message-ID: <20150930122020.GE3383@phenom.ffwll.local> References: <1441420391-19109-1-git-send-email-chandra.konduru@intel.com> <1441420391-19109-2-git-send-email-chandra.konduru@intel.com> <20150929174505.GB26517@intel.com> Mime-Version: 1.0 Content-Type: text/plain; charset="utf-8" Content-Transfer-Encoding: base64 Return-path: Received: from mail-wi0-f181.google.com (mail-wi0-f181.google.com [209.85.212.181]) by gabe.freedesktop.org (Postfix) with ESMTPS id 05CAA6E38E for ; Wed, 30 Sep 2015 05:17:26 -0700 (PDT) Received: by wiclk2 with SMTP id lk2so58845160wic.1 for ; Wed, 30 Sep 2015 05:17:25 -0700 (PDT) Content-Disposition: inline In-Reply-To: <20150929174505.GB26517@intel.com> List-Unsubscribe: , List-Archive: List-Post: List-Help: List-Subscribe: , Errors-To: intel-gfx-bounces@lists.freedesktop.org Sender: "Intel-gfx" To: Ville =?iso-8859-1?Q?Syrj=E4l=E4?= Cc: daniel.vetter@intel.com, intel-gfx@lists.freedesktop.org, ville.syrjala@intel.com List-Id: intel-gfx@lists.freedesktop.org T24gVHVlLCBTZXAgMjksIDIwMTUgYXQgMDg6NDU6MDVQTSArMDMwMCwgVmlsbGUgU3lyasOkbMOk IHdyb3RlOgo+IE9uIEZyaSwgU2VwIDA0LCAyMDE1IGF0IDA3OjMyOjU3UE0gLTA3MDAsIENoYW5k cmEgS29uZHVydSB3cm90ZToKPiA+IFByb3Blcmx5IGFsbG9jYXRlIG1pbiBibG9ja3MgcGVyIGh3 IHJlcXVpcmVtZW50cy4KPiA+IAo+ID4gdjI6Cj4gPiAtIGNoYW5nZWQgaGVscGVyIGZ1bmN0aW9u YWwgcGFyYW0gdG8gYm9vbCwgc29tZSBjb2RlIHNpbXBsaWZpY2F0aW9uIChWaWxsZSkKPiA+IAo+ ID4gU2lnbmVkLW9mZi1ieTogQ2hhbmRyYSBLb25kdXJ1IDxjaGFuZHJhLmtvbmR1cnVAaW50ZWwu Y29tPgo+IAo+IElJUkMgSSBnYXZlIG15IHItYiBhbHJhZHk/CgpZdXAsIGl0IHdhcyBhIGNvbmRp dGlvbmFsIHItYiAoImZpeCB0aGlzIHRpbnkgdGhpbmcgYW5kIHlvdSBoYXZlIHRoZSByLWIiKQpz b21ld2hlbiBpbiBBdWd1c3QuCgpDaGFuZHJhIGluIHRoYXQgY2FzZSBwbGVhc2UgYWRkIHRoZSBy LWIgeW91cnNlbGYgdG8gYXZvaWQgd2FzdGluZyBwZW9wbGUncwp0aW1lLiBBbHNvLCBub3QgZG9p bmcgdGhhdCBqdXN0IGluY3JlYXNlcyB0aGUgY2hhbmdlcyB0aGF0IHNvbWVvbmUgd2lsbApzcG90 IHNvbWV0aGluZyBuZXcgOy0pCi1EYW5pZWwKCgo+IAo+IEJ1dCBJJ2xsIHRvc3MgaXQgaW4gYWdh aW46Cj4gUmV2aWV3ZWQtYnk6IFZpbGxlIFN5cmrDpGzDpCA8dmlsbGUuc3lyamFsYUBsaW51eC5p bnRlbC5jb20+Cj4gCj4gPiAtLS0KPiA+ICBkcml2ZXJzL2dwdS9kcm0vaTkxNS9pbnRlbF9wbS5j IHwgICAyOSArKysrKysrKysrKysrKysrKysrKysrKysrKystLQo+ID4gIDEgZmlsZSBjaGFuZ2Vk LCAyNyBpbnNlcnRpb25zKCspLCAyIGRlbGV0aW9ucygtKQo+ID4gCj4gPiBkaWZmIC0tZ2l0IGEv ZHJpdmVycy9ncHUvZHJtL2k5MTUvaW50ZWxfcG0uYyBiL2RyaXZlcnMvZ3B1L2RybS9pOTE1L2lu dGVsX3BtLmMKPiA+IGluZGV4IGZmZjBjMjIuLjRkM2FjYTAgMTAwNjQ0Cj4gPiAtLS0gYS9kcml2 ZXJzL2dwdS9kcm0vaTkxNS9pbnRlbF9wbS5jCj4gPiArKysgYi9kcml2ZXJzL2dwdS9kcm0vaTkx NS9pbnRlbF9wbS5jCj4gPiBAQCAtMjk1OSw2ICsyOTU5LDMxIEBAIHNrbF9nZXRfdG90YWxfcmVs YXRpdmVfZGF0YV9yYXRlKHN0cnVjdCBpbnRlbF9jcnRjICppbnRlbF9jcnRjLAo+ID4gIAlyZXR1 cm4gdG90YWxfZGF0YV9yYXRlOwo+ID4gIH0KPiA+ICAKPiA+ICtzdGF0aWMgdWludDE2X3QKPiA+ ICtza2xfZGJ1Zl9taW5fYWxsb2MoY29uc3Qgc3RydWN0IGludGVsX3BsYW5lX3dtX3BhcmFtZXRl cnMgKnAsIGJvb2wgeV9wbGFuZSkKPiA+ICt7Cj4gPiArCXVpbnQxNl90IG1pbl9hbGxvYzsKPiA+ ICsKPiA+ICsJLyogRm9yIHBhY2tlZCBmb3JtYXRzLCBubyB5LXBsYW5lLCByZXR1cm4gMCAqLwo+ ID4gKwlpZiAoeV9wbGFuZSAmJiAhcC0+eV9ieXRlc19wZXJfcGl4ZWwpCj4gPiArCQlyZXR1cm4g MDsKPiA+ICsKPiA+ICsJaWYgKHAtPnRpbGluZyA9PSBJOTE1X0ZPUk1BVF9NT0RfWV9USUxFRCB8 fAo+ID4gKwkgICAgcC0+dGlsaW5nID09IEk5MTVfRk9STUFUX01PRF9ZZl9USUxFRCkgewo+ID4g KwkJdWludDMyX3QgbWluX3NjYW5saW5lcyA9IDg7Cj4gPiArCQl1aW50OF90IGJ5dGVzX3Blcl9w aXhlbCA9Cj4gPiArCQkJeV9wbGFuZSA/IHAtPnlfYnl0ZXNfcGVyX3BpeGVsIDogcC0+Ynl0ZXNf cGVyX3BpeGVsOwo+ID4gKwo+ID4gKwkJbWluX3NjYW5saW5lcyA9IDMyIC8gYnl0ZXNfcGVyX3Bp eGVsOwo+ID4gKwkJbWluX2FsbG9jID0gRElWX1JPVU5EX1VQKCg0ICogcC0+aG9yaXpfcGl4ZWxz Lyh5X3BsYW5lID8gMSA6IDIpICoKPiA+ICsJCQlieXRlc19wZXJfcGl4ZWwpLCA1MTIpICogbWlu X3NjYW5saW5lcy80ICsgMzsKPiA+ICsJfSBlbHNlIHsKPiA+ICsJCW1pbl9hbGxvYyA9IDg7Cj4g PiArCX0KPiA+ICsKPiA+ICsJcmV0dXJuIG1pbl9hbGxvYzsKPiA+ICt9Cj4gPiArCj4gPiAgc3Rh dGljIHZvaWQKPiA+ICBza2xfYWxsb2NhdGVfcGlwZV9kZGIoc3RydWN0IGRybV9jcnRjICpjcnRj LAo+ID4gIAkJICAgICAgY29uc3Qgc3RydWN0IGludGVsX3dtX2NvbmZpZyAqY29uZmlnLAo+ID4g QEAgLTI5OTksOSArMzAyNCw5IEBAIHNrbF9hbGxvY2F0ZV9waXBlX2RkYihzdHJ1Y3QgZHJtX2Ny dGMgKmNydGMsCj4gPiAgCQlpZiAoIXAtPmVuYWJsZWQpCj4gPiAgCQkJY29udGludWU7Cj4gPiAg Cj4gPiAtCQltaW5pbXVtW3BsYW5lXSA9IDg7Cj4gPiArCQltaW5pbXVtW3BsYW5lXSA9IHNrbF9k YnVmX21pbl9hbGxvYyhwLCBmYWxzZSk7ICAgLyogdXYtcGxhbmUvcGFja2VkICovCj4gPiAgCQlh bGxvY19zaXplIC09IG1pbmltdW1bcGxhbmVdOwo+ID4gLQkJeV9taW5pbXVtW3BsYW5lXSA9IHAt PnlfYnl0ZXNfcGVyX3BpeGVsID8gOCA6IDA7Cj4gPiArCQl5X21pbmltdW1bcGxhbmVdID0gc2ts X2RidWZfbWluX2FsbG9jKHAsIHRydWUpOyAgLyogeS1wbGFuZSAqLwo+ID4gIAkJYWxsb2Nfc2l6 ZSAtPSB5X21pbmltdW1bcGxhbmVdOwo+ID4gIAl9Cj4gPiAgCj4gPiAtLSAKPiA+IDEuNy45LjUK PiA+IAo+ID4gX19fX19fX19fX19fX19fX19fX19fX19fX19fX19fX19fX19fX19fX19fX19fX18K PiA+IEludGVsLWdmeCBtYWlsaW5nIGxpc3QKPiA+IEludGVsLWdmeEBsaXN0cy5mcmVlZGVza3Rv cC5vcmcKPiA+IGh0dHA6Ly9saXN0cy5mcmVlZGVza3RvcC5vcmcvbWFpbG1hbi9saXN0aW5mby9p bnRlbC1nZngKPiAKPiAtLSAKPiBWaWxsZSBTeXJqw6Rsw6QKPiBJbnRlbCBPVEMKPiBfX19fX19f X19fX19fX19fX19fX19fX19fX19fX19fX19fX19fX19fX19fX19fXwo+IEludGVsLWdmeCBtYWls aW5nIGxpc3QKPiBJbnRlbC1nZnhAbGlzdHMuZnJlZWRlc2t0b3Aub3JnCj4gaHR0cDovL2xpc3Rz LmZyZWVkZXNrdG9wLm9yZy9tYWlsbWFuL2xpc3RpbmZvL2ludGVsLWdmeAoKLS0gCkRhbmllbCBW ZXR0ZXIKU29mdHdhcmUgRW5naW5lZXIsIEludGVsIENvcnBvcmF0aW9uCmh0dHA6Ly9ibG9nLmZm d2xsLmNoCl9fX19fX19fX19fX19fX19fX19fX19fX19fX19fX19fX19fX19fX19fX19fX19fCklu dGVsLWdmeCBtYWlsaW5nIGxpc3QKSW50ZWwtZ2Z4QGxpc3RzLmZyZWVkZXNrdG9wLm9yZwpodHRw Oi8vbGlzdHMuZnJlZWRlc2t0b3Aub3JnL21haWxtYW4vbGlzdGluZm8vaW50ZWwtZ2Z4Cg==